datum-merge

datum-merge is a modern typescript library that simplifies merge and diff operations for deeply nested objects.

Sample Usage

Merge with default config:

import { merge, detailMerge, UpdateCode } from "datum-merge";
let changed = merge(target, source, UpdateCode.I, UpdateCode.XM, UpdateCode.B);
//same as
changed = customMerge(target, source, { 
    scalar: UpdateCode.I, 
    vector: UpdateCode.XM, 
    nested: UpdateCode.B 
});

Exact nestable config that ignores all other fields:

changed = detailMerge(target, source, {
    mykey: UpdateCode.I, 
    myarr: UpdateCode.XM, 
    anobj: UpdateCode.B,
    myobj: { myid: UpdateCode.I },
});

Deep merge with generic config patterns:

import { customMerge, MergeConfig, UpdateCode } from "datum-merge";
const conf: MergeConfig = {
    "*_id": UpdateCode.I,
    scalar: UpdateCode.B,
    field1: UpdateCode.D,
    "arr*": UpdateCode.XM,
    nested: UpdatedCode.N,
    obj1: {
        scalar: UpdateCode.B,
        vector: UpdateCode.XM,
    },
};
let diff = customMerge(target, source, conf);

Merge Strategy

This string code describes how modifications to an attribute for a PUT/UPDATE operation should be handled. It decides whether a change to the value of the field is allowed during a merge between two entities.

Strategy Codes

The same field within a source and target object is represented by s and t respectively. Whether the strategy requires data to be present for the field, is shown by { 0=no, 1=yes, X=irrelavant }. The value is migrated from the source field to the target field only if the predicate passes.

Code Value Predicate Meaning
C n/a always create new instance
T n/a touch datum ; empty merge
N 0 reject any change ; skip merge
Y sX & tX accept any change ; bypass merge
B s1 & tX insert or update, no delete
H s1 & t1 update only if exists
U sX & t1 update or delete only, no insert
I sX & t0 insert only, no update or delete
D s0 & tX delete only, no update or insert
XR sX & tX full vector replacement
XM s ∪ t set union, vector merge
XD s - t set difference, delete given values
XI s ∩ t set intersection, delete missing values
XS t + s preserve order insert (allows dupes)
XF s + t insert from start (allows dupes)

Diff Codes

Applying the merge results in one of these transitions per primitive value in the target object.

Code Value Meaning Transitions
Z noop / ignore null <-- null or non-null == non-null
N new / insert null <-- non-null
E edit / update non-null <-- non-null
D unset / delete non-null <-- null
AN array size increase (tbd) non-null > non-null
AD array size decrease (tbd) non-null < non-null
